About the Role

We’re seeking a dependable Building Engineer Technician to maintain a clean, safe, and efficient distribution center. In this role, you’ll help protect our team by ensuring hazards are addressed promptly, emergency exits are clear, and facility spaces are well-maintained.


What You'll Do

  • Clean and maintain shipping docks, restrooms, offices, and common areas.
  • Ensure emergency exits, railings, and safety zones are free of hazards.
  • Perform routine deep cleaning (dusting, windows, vents, power washing).
  • Restock supplies, reorganize storage areas, and update cleaning logs.
  • Patrol the property and report or resolve safety concerns.


What Success Looks Like

  • The facility is consistently clean, safe, and free of hazards.
  • Emergency exits, docks, and work areas always remain unobstructed.
  • Cleaning supplies and tools are stocked, and storage areas stay organized.
  • Deep-cleaning tasks are completed on schedule and documented.
  • Employees and visitors notice and appreciate a well-maintained environment that supports safe operations.


What You’ll Need to Succeed

  • Strong attention to detail and commitment to workplace safety.
  • Ability to manage daily, weekly, and monthly cleaning schedules.
  • Comfortable working in a distribution center environment.
  • Reliable, self-motivated, and able to work independently.
  • Relevant experience aligned with the responsibilities of this role
